Output 76f99118e4aa524dbc9de37056f8004e810dfce45ad6aebfe80b9947f6301afa:0

value
84928307
script pubkey
OP_0 OP_PUSHBYTES_20 e66d8545c5f3fdbef2b621983fcfa3b52985511f
address
bc1quekc23w9707mau4kyxvrlnark55c25glemxrxe
transaction
76f99118e4aa524dbc9de37056f8004e810dfce45ad6aebfe80b9947f6301afa
confirmations
348184
spent
true